Handover note — Crumbwheel order cutoffs.

Welcome aboard. The bakery cutoff rule in Crumbwheel closes same-day orders at 14:00 local to each storefront, not UTC — this has bitten us twice. Holiday overrides live in the calendar service and take precedence silently, so always check there first when a cutoff looks wrong. To unlock the calendar service's admin console after a restart, enter the recovery passphrase below.

vault phrase of bagap-bahaf = silion-pelox-sorox-casdor-quenwyn-fraax-eliox-praael-kelion-quenvan-kasox-rusael-norius-belvan

## Service Accounts: Retrying Failed Exports

Plugin authors integrating with the Lumavert Export Gateway should treat export failures as transient by default. Retry with exponential backoff (base 2s, cap 60s, max 5 attempts), and honor the `Retry-After` header when present. Idempotency tokens are required on every retry to prevent duplicate export jobs. All retry calls must authenticate via the shared service account credential shown below.

API key for tagef-fafop: vxb2-ta

**Audit item 7: Lanternflag rollout framework.** Quick reality check for future maintainers: the flag framework does staged rollouts by cohort, but the cohort hashing changed in v3 and old flags were never rehashed. That means a handful of pre-v3 flags have lopsided exposure — check the audit spreadsheet before trusting any rollout percentages. Also confirm the kill-switch path actually flips within 60 seconds; we've seen cache staleness bite us twice. If anything here looks off, raise it with the framework's responsible owner.

approver of yawig-yajef = Briius Jorix